why not study the stock pk3's and try to get some steps further. Maybe, if u would ask specfic questions, u get help...

lilttle hint: ur loading screen is in Pak1.pk3/textures/mohmenu/levelbriefing/m1|1_1.tga. Something u ought to have found out urself and which would explain how e.g. a knife can be added
